China Yangtze River Shipping Group Changjiang Ship Design Institute and European customers officially signed the LPG design order for 3500 cubic meters full-pressure liquefied gas carrier, marking the initial realization of China Changhang Air Liquide Transport Ship design technology from the domestic design market to the international design market. The transformation is upgraded.

In recent years, China's liquefied petroleum gas and other energy demand is strong, the liquefied petroleum gas transportation market is promising, and the bulk liquefied gas transportation on the water has the advantages of safety, reliability, and large quantity and low price. Various liquefied gas ship types are favored by the market. China Changhang Ship Design Institute seized the opportunity to strengthen scientific and technological innovation and speed up the research and development and market development of new ship types with higher added value such as liquefied gas. It has successively built and completed 1,700 cubic meters, 2000 cubic meters, 2,500 cubic meters and 3000. The series of liquefied gas ship design tasks such as cubic meters, 3,500 cubic meters, 3,600 cubic meters, 3,700 cubic meters, and 4000 cubic meters are in a leading position in the design market of China's full-pressure liquefied gas ship type, and occupy the domestic ship design. The market share of about 80% of the market has formed its core competitiveness and corporate brand.

Through continuous technological innovation, the design institute successfully solved technical difficulties such as design of liquid tank and liquid cargo system, hull structure and stress analysis of liquid tank saddle, and met the requirements of ship type standardization and anti-pollution performance as well as comprehensive energy conservation. The praise of shipowners and shipyards has formed a series of design technologies for liquefied gas transport vessels with independent intellectual property rights, and has achieved a high market awareness.

The ship type has high requirements in terms of load capacity, living standard, vibration noise, comprehensive performance, equipment selection, automation degree and anti-pollution. Its structure and process will meet the requirements of BV classification society and relevant international standards, electrical equipment and navigation. Equipment and communications equipment will meet the requirements of the CSQS standard and relevant international standards. The ship type is built according to the current regulations and rules of the French BV classification society and under the special inspection of BV.
